✦ Synopsis


DDT resistance in adults of the BKPM3 strain ofAedes aegypti, homozygous for the pyrethroid resistance gene RPY, was found to be due to factors on both chromosomes II and III. No evidence was found to suggest the presence of factors conferring resistance to permethrin on chromosome II and consequently that DDT resistance factor(s) on this chromosome are related to permethrin resistance. Further confirmation that RPY is the major gene controlling pyrethroid resistance was obtained and also evidence that it is closely linked or allelic to the chromosome III DDT resistance factor.
